McDonalds has become the latest U.S. company to ditch its ridiculous and costly woke DEI policies, joining the growing list of corporations giving up on the “inclusive” programs they implemented as publicity stunts following the death of George Floyd back in 2020 - likely in an effort to keep their brick-and-mortars from being torched to the ground by angry mobs.
In an open letter to employees citing the 2023 Supreme Court decision on affirmative action and the “evolving landscape around DEI,” the global fast food franchise says they will no longer hire people based on filling race, gender, LGBTQ, or other characteristic-based quotas, and won’t choose suppliers based on the same.

According to Fox Business, “The changes include McDonald's scrapping its ‘aspirational representation goals,’ getting rid of its DEI pledge for its suppliers, changing the name of its diversity team to the Global Inclusion Team and ending external surveys.”
The latter implies the company will no longer participate in the Human Rights Campaign’s Corporate Equality Index, an annual poll by the far-left LGBTQ advocacy group the promotes and gauges “policies, practices and benefits pertinent to l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ender and queer (LGBTQ+) employees."
Walmart, Ford, and John Deere have already announced they’ve canceled some or all of their expensive DEI policies, with Walmart closing their five-year, $100 million “equity racial center” after realizing it didn’t exactly do anything.
